Ordinals
beta
Address bc1p45fgt3p7h522elpm0qg0yqzyc5mecst566eepqdf38zttj87k68qscth43
sat balance
8099882
runes balances
outputs
7daf2da0dcfc2027290cc46ab0e80c448ada375bd5254ef32caab18c00df169f:3